Output d73d66257a607c81acb8129a525623ecaf7326def0126df9764275fa75e38c13:0

value
3612480
script pubkey
OP_0 OP_PUSHBYTES_20 31289f2cc228a8c99e741b0bacf9366f62900b73
address
ltc1qxy5f7txz9z5vn8n5rv96e7fkda3fqzmn3fygj7
transaction
d73d66257a607c81acb8129a525623ecaf7326def0126df9764275fa75e38c13
spent
true